EXCESS INVENTORY: A WARNING FOR VIETNAMESE BUSINESSES
Excess inventory is becoming a “strategic nightmare” in the context of a volatile global economy. Supply chain bottlenecks – such as port congestion or raw material shortages – are gradually removed from mid-2022. Consumer demand declines. Inflation and tight monetary policy make consumers in the US and EU – Vietnam’s two main export markets – spend less, leading to a serious backlog of goods. Inventory not only “eats up” capital but also entails a series of consequences:
Rising storage costs: Logistics costs in Vietnam account for 16-20% of GDP, higher than Thailand (11-13%), according to Vietnam Investment Review, 2023. Warehouse rent, electricity, labor, and storage costs eat into profits, especially when inventory is damaged or obsolete, such as in the food and fashion industries.
Missed business opportunities: Capital tied up in inventory prevents you from investing in new products, expanding into new markets, or improving technology. “Cash is king, and inventory is a robber,” Jeff Bezos, founder of Amazon, once emphasized the importance of effective inventory management.
Losing customer trust: Incorrect forecasts leave you short of products customers need, while your warehouse is full of unsold goods. Vietnam E-commerce Report, 2023 recorded that 80% of Vietnamese consumers expect to receive their goods within 1-2 days. If they cannot meet this, they will switch to competitors like Shopee or Lazada, which have invested heavily in automated warehouses.
Excess inventory is not just a short-term problem – it is a strategic warning that your business needs to change to survive and grow. “Incorrect inventory is a failure of the whole system, not just the logistics department,” Mr. Tran Dinh Thien, former Director of the Vietnam Economic Institute, emphasized at the Hanoi conference in 2023. WHY IS EXCESS INVENTORY A "TIME BOMB"?
To thoroughly solve the excess inventory, it is necessary to isolate the root cause:

Poor demand forecasting: Market volatility due to inflation, trade wars, and changes in consumer behavior makes forecasting difficult. Many Vietnamese businesses still rely on outdated experience or tools, leading to large errors. For example, in the food industry, incorrect forecasting of Tet sales volume can lead to damaged goods or months of backlog.
Manual warehouse management: According to VCCI, 2022, 65% of small and medium enterprises in Vietnam have not applied a modern warehouse management system. Manual processes such as using Excel cause inventory errors, loss of goods, and slow order processing.
Asynchronous data: “Asynchronous data is the number one enemy of good decisions,” an expert on Business Insider, 2021 emphasized. PwC Vietnam, 2022 pointed out that 70% of Vietnamese enterprises have difficulty integrating supply chain data, causing leaders to lack a comprehensive view.
Lack of technology investment: While international and domestic giants such as Amazon or Shopee invest in automated warehouses and ERP, many Vietnamese businesses still struggle with outdated technology and cannot optimize their supply chains.
